Perfect Homemade Cajun Seasoning
This easy homemade Cajun Seasoning originating from Louisiana is super versatile and it’s made from commonly used spices in Cajun cuisine. You’ll need basic ingredients such as paprika cayenne, garlic powder and pepper.

Ingredients
3
tbsp
smoked paprika
2
tbsp
kosher salt
1
tbsp
ground black pepper
2
tbsp
garlic powder
1
tbsp
onion powder
1
tbsp
ground white pepper
1
tbsp
dried oregano
1
tbsp
cayenne pepper
1
tbsp
dried thyme
Instructions
In a shallow bowl combine all the ingredients.
Transfer the Cajun Seasoning to a glass jar with airtight lids. Store in a cool, dark place for up to 1 year.
